Runbook: Gaugelet metrics sidecar — restart procedure

If the Gaugelet sidecar stops flushing aggregates, check the local spool first; over 2GB means the upstream collector is down. Drain the spool, restart the sidecar, and confirm flush latency drops under 5s within two minutes. Do not clear the spool manually — it replays automatically. If the restart loops, escalate to the platform channel and include the running build token shown below.

pipeline stamp: htk9_ce63042d9

Facilities Ticket — Cleaning Crew Access, Brindle Annex

For new starters handling evening lock-up: the Sorano Cleaning crew arrives nightly at 21:30 via the annex side door. Check their rota sheet, note arrival in the log, and ensure the storeroom is relocked afterward. To let them through the side door, enter the access code below.

badge for yaweg-hafog: bdg-GX-6

Onboarding: garage occupancy feed (Perchline). The feed ingests sensor counts from the Halverton deck every 30s via the Stallgrid collector. If counts flatline, restart the collector pod first — nine times out of ten it's a stuck socket. Dashboards live under `perchline-occupancy`. Alerts page on-call after 5 min of silence. Escalate to the platform channel if restarts fail twice. To unlock the collector's sealed config, use the recovery passphrase below.

unlock words, yawig-kagef: gordor-holvan-ulaael-pramir-ulaiel-tamdor

Hey Priya — handing off the Reportrix sort-stability fix before my rotation ends. Short version: the builder's merge step wasn't stable, so rows with equal keys shuffled between runs, which made audit diffs noisy and looked like tampering (it wasn't). I swapped in a stable sort and pinned the tiebreaker to row ingest order. For your review, nothing touches auth paths. The sorter reads its runtime settings from the config block below.

config for bawig-fadup:
[zorix]
host = zorix.lumicworks.corp
user = zorix_svc
database = zorix_prod